AI Summary
-
Defines "air ambulance service" as any public or private entity using an air ambulance to transport patients to a medical facility.
-
Requires all air ambulance services operating in Colorado to obtain department licensure, with compliance through board-adopted rules or accreditation by an approved organization with equivalent or exceeding standards.
-
Establishes new regulatory framework allowing provisional and conditional licenses, emergency waivers for rule requirements, and recognition of out-of-state licenses for limited flights, with civil penalties up to $5,000 per violation.
-
Directs the board to promulgate rules by December 30, 2017, covering medical crew qualifications, insurance requirements, equipment standards, data reporting, and patient safety management.
-
Appropriates $21,836 to the Department of Public Health and Environment for fiscal year 2016-17 to implement air ambulance regulation ($18,036 for staffing and planning, $3,800 for legal services).
